After two years, it was great to interview cellist Inbal Segev about the third volume of her 20 for 2020 project that delightfully expands the repertoire with a set of brand new compositions.
In our conversation, we discuss 20 for 2020 Volume 3 and the new work that Inbal is doing, including a planned trip to London in October.
